31 Jul, 2008 8:10 am by Howard Friedman
Today's New York Daily News reports that Scientology critic Peter Letterese has filed a $250 million federal lawsuit under the Racketeer Influenced and Corrupt Organizations statute against the Church of ... various Scientology-related organizations is an elaborate criminal syndicate which sought to infringe intellectual property rights to a book by author Leslie Dane. Letterese bought the rights to the book in question from Dane's estate. Earlier this month in Peter Letteresse & Associates, Inc ...

17 Sep, 2008 9:46 am by A. Benjamin Spencer
Per Peter Letterese And Associates, Inc. v. World Institute Of Scientology Enterprises, 533 F.3d 1287 (11th Cir. Jul 08, 2008): We next consider whether summary judgment for defendants was appropriate as to Count 1 on the alternate ground that PL&A's claim is barred by the defense of laches, which prevents a plaintiff who has slept on his rights from enforcing those rights against a defendant. The question whether the equitable doctrine of laches may bar a claim for copyright ...
